    A home full of nightmares.

    Alas de Mariposa is about a 6-year-old girl, Ami that lives in a home full of nightmares. Her mother, Carmen, has an obsession to give birth to a male. She wants to carry on the patriarchal name of her husband, Gabriel. For that reason, Carmen does not treat Ami with the love and respect that she needs and deserves. She often ignores Ami and tells her to leave her alone. Ami's father, Gabriel, is a hardworking garbage man that tries to keep the family together. He often tries to comfort Ami, since her mother will not. Ami's butterfly drawings as a child, turn into dark, skeletal remains of a butterfly as she grows older. Gabriel finally get fed up with all of the arguing and tension in the home and asks Ami to leave the house. This movie is full of terror for Ami--involving murder,hatred,and rape. You will notice the rejection of a female in this film and how Ami is victimized by the society's ideologies. Juanma uses several strategies to create this "dark and tragic" environment.

    Downbeat but excellent film about tragic deeds occur a family and lead a cruel nightmare

    Emotive drama about an unfortunate family with engaging interpretation , breathtaking cinematography and acceptable direction . This Spanish picture is an enjoyable story with an interesting characterizing about a few characters , tragic drama and thought-provoking events . That picture caught the attention of the Spanish media and spectators because of its shocking visual style and the crude scenario . It deals with an extremely sensitive little girl named Ami (Laura Vaquero) . She is a 6 year old girl who lives with her father named Gabriel (Fernando Valverde) , mother and grandfather (Txema Blasco) . Her mother, Carmen (Silvia Munt) , bears the obsession of giving a son to her husband . When finally Carmen gets pregnant, the relation between mother and daughter becomes a tragic one, driving the family to an inevitable tragedy .

    This interesting but depressing film contains human drama , passion , emotion , tragical events , complemented with a colorful cinematography and sensitive musical score . These elements provide the setting for this piece of dramatic deeds , giving it its own special quality and ambient ; making a strong description of a drama inside a problematic family . After two years of writing along with his brother Eduardo , Ulloa , helped by filmmaker Fernando Trueba , produced and directed his first long movie "Alas De Mariposa" . This film along with ¨La Madre Muerta¨ forms a splendid diptych in which stands out its darkness , gloomy familiar environment and deep drama , both of them were shot in Vitoria ; however his third film ¨Airbag¨ disappointed some of his longtime buffs who preferred the obscurity of his first movies . ¨Butterfly wings¨ was released in the Festival of Cine of San Sebastian it won the first prize and subsequently won awards in many international festivals . Later came 3 Goyas of the Spanish academy such as best first movie , actress and original screenplay . Top-notch protagonist trio , Fernando Valverde-Silvia Munt-Susana Garcia , all of them give fine acting . The storyline relies heavily on the continued relationship among them but it doesn't make boring , however the film is slow moving . The little girl named Laura Vaquero is marvelous and charming with her sweet and enjoyable countenance . Good support cast formed by a plethora of notorious Spanish actors such as Txema Blasco as the grandfather and brief cameo by Karra Elejalde as a neighbour . Colorful and evocative cinematography by Aitor Mantxola , filmed on location in Vitoria , Pais Vasco , where the same director was born and lives . Emotive as well as thrilling musical score by Bingen Mendizabal .

    Juanma Bajo Ulloa is a good but little prolific filmmaker . In 1989 he filmed his first movie in 35 mm , "The kingdom of Victor" that won the Goya of the Spanish academy to the best short movie . His first long film was the successful ¨Butterfly wings¨ that achieved numerous national and international prizes . In 1993, he realized his second picture , considered to be his best by many of his aficionados , "La Madre Muerta" that won prizes in several Festivals like Venice and Montreal . In 1996, his third movie , "Airbag" , an action road-movie , became the biggest Spanish box-office hit of all time , being a real international success . However this success , he has been unable to make any other movie in the last 8 years . He attempted to adapt the Spanish comic hero "Capitán Trueno" but the producers turned him down , and being finally realized by Antonio Hernandez . Others projects couldn't be financed due to creative differences with producers. In 2004 he filmed in secret, and with his own money, his fourth movie, "Fragil", that will be released in 2005 but was a commercial flop .

    Those eyes

    I am with some other reviews who say in this movie there are two different part. The first, when she was a little kid, and the second, she as a teen. The first half, the star as a kid is awesome, nothing more, nothing less. Perfect length too. The aesthetic, blue tone, somber tale and perfect cast in this disturbing and sad story combine to produce one of the Spanish cinema peaks in the 90's. The other half, it's not bad as many people said, but with any trace of doubt the quality drops a lot. Annoying new characters, the loss of the atmosphere because the movie escapes to reality from that isolated world tale from the first half. Movie changed. Great technical work, good music and casting (specially the two girls who has disappeared from the scene inexplicably).

    "Alas de mariposa" potently challenges the viewer with the re-examination of the female in a patriarchal society.

    Although we live under the premise that equality between men and women has consistently improved over the past three decades, the potent film "Alas de mariposa" ("Wings of the Butterfly") presents a startling contrast to this notion. Set in the Basque region of Spain, the director Juanma Bajo Ulloa portrays a modern family in the 1990's who is consumed with the obsession to have a son to carry on the family name. Ironically, it is the mother, Carmen, who is determined to continue the patriarchal dominance rather than the submissive father, Gabriel, as a result of living under the shadow of her father's resentment. While focusing on the repression of the feminine identity and the subsequent violence that is imposed upon the young daughter Ami, the spectator can draw parallels to the repression of the Basque independence and identity in the Northeast section of Spain.

    While using revealing chiaroscuro lighting, "Alas de mariposa" contains various symbolic scenes that augment the patriarchal ideology through closed frames which denote the trapped family. The opening scene of the movie summarizes the rejection of the female throughout the film when the grandfather refuses to accept the birth of his granddaughter. Preceding scenes of the storm, ruination of the family painting that Ami draws, Carmen's rejection of Ami during her pregnancy and even the egg that breaks during the parallel montage of Ami's fall represents the broken possibility of life. The only moments in which Ami, the daughter, feels free and uninhibited is through the creation of her art, yet ironically the only time she can draw the butterfly wings is between the death of her grandfather and the birth of her little brother. The butterfly wings seem to symbolize her momentary freedom and liberty, while the skeletal frame represents her lack of freedom.

    The vicious ideological circle in "Alas de mariposa" slowly rotates around the father's idealist attitude, the mother's forceful dominance, the daughter's rejection, the pregnancies and hurtful actions. The entire film encourages the viewer to evaluate the remaining patriarchal holds still remnant in society. "Alas de mariposa" is a compelling movie that questions the force of ideologies, portrays the victims and offenders of these philosophies, and the effect that they have on freedom and liberty. It is an eye-opening movie that challenges the audience with the re-examination of creeds that society imposes on the individual as well as the group.
